[quote="XtremeZero";p="485419"]I'm interested in seeing the movie, although I never read any of the books. WOuld it be better to read the books first then go see the movie?[/quote]
Reading the book is nice, but keep this one thing in mind : EVERY time D.A. changed formats with this story, much of it remains the same, but he ALWAYS changed it. And from what I hear, the movie is no different. So, read the book - but don't be upset or surprised when it doesn't exactly jive with what you see on screen.
